Bachelor of Science BSc

Bachelor of Science (BSc) is an undergraduate academic degree awarded for the completion of three to five years courses. In the United States, a BSc is usually a four-year undergraduate degree typically used in computer science, mathematics, engineering and the natural sciences.

Does the material of safety boots need to be light or heavy?

The weight of materials in safety boots is not really an important factor. What's important is for the material to be strong. Older safety boots are usually made with steel covering the toes, which protected them from heavy items being dropped on them. Newer Safety boots can be made with titanium or special plastic coverings that protect your toes just as well, but are much lighter.

What are the advantages and disadvantages of elliptic filter?

advantages:

1. It has a sharp cut-off and narrow transition width.

2. The frequency response specifications can be satisfied by a lower order filter.

3. Due to presence of zeroes unlike butterworth, chebyshev, it can effectively notch out frequencies.

disadvantages:

1. It has ripples both in passband as well as stopband.

2. It has a highly non-linear phase response in passband especially near band-edge.

3. Design and implementation is complicated.

What is the difference between BTech and BSc?

A BTech is a technical degree focused on practical applications, while a BSc is a broader science degree that covers a wider range of subjects. BTech programs often have a more vocational focus and may include hands-on training, while a BSc typically offers a more theoretical understanding of science. Ultimately, the choice between the two may depend on your career goals and interests.

What is a bachelor of science degree?

The Bachelor of Arts degree (BA) has a broader scope, with a strong emphasis on the humanities, theoretical and general knowledge in a recognized discipline, interdisciplinary field, or of a professional study.

The Bachelor of Science degree (BS) is more of a focused approach with a science base to include a balance of liberal arts, technological knowledge, math and computer oriented skills, and practical skills needed for a particular discipline within the field.

How do you sign your name when you have two masters degrees and want to use the degree suffixes?

If the two degrees are the same (MA and MA) then you would use just the one. Example: John Doe MA.If they are different, then use the two.Example: John Doe MA, MS.
